Senior Analyst Silicon Business Operations
NVIDIA is a leading company in computer graphics and accelerated computing, pioneering technology to tackle unique challenges. They are seeking a Senior Analyst for Silicon Business Operations to drive operational efficiency, strategic planning, and business growth, overseeing key aspects of silicon operations and ensuring timely delivery of high-quality silicon products.

Responsibilities
Lead and manage aspects of silicon business operations, including wafer and advance packaging supply chain management, capacity, pricing, and contract negotiations, product roadmap influence, and relationship management. Help shape and influence our production process decisions to ensure flawless execution and world-class results
Assist with business negotiations including preparation of RFQs for product tape out awards, pricing, capacity allocations, and other key business drivers
Assist the business team, ensuring they are equipped to meet our operational goals and respond to challenges with agility
Thrive in problem-solving and react swiftly to issues, maintaining the seamless flow of operations in a dynamic environment
Influence upper management by highlighting competitive technologies, ensuring timely decisions that support our business objectives
Partner with suppliers to secure expedites, supporting new product ramps and mitigating urgent shortages
Resolve capacity constraints by collaborating with suppliers, internal planning, and engineering teams, ensuring smooth operations and minimal disruptions
Work closely with the BU, Engineering, and Ops teams on advance packaging roadmaps and production ramps, aligning efforts to mitigate potential risks and ensure successful product launches
Manage foundry partner relationships and be a key individual to initiate/handle escalations
